What you need: 

Small white flowers (I used baby’s breath)

Small red flowers

Clear hair elastics

Hair brush

Begin by brushing your hair and creating a middle part. Split your hair into two equal sections on either side of your head.

The ultimate goal is to have three braids on each side of your head, totaling six overall. Start at the very top on one side, making the start of a small braid. Begin pulling small amounts of hair into the braid as you work back and down your head. Essentially you are french braiding your hair, but in a small 1-2 inch section.

Once you’ve pulled in all the hair in that section, return to a regular braid. Stop a few inches from the bottom of your hair and secure the end with a clear elastic.

Continue repeating this on the 1-2 inch section below the top braid, and then the section below that. When you have finished one side, mirror it on the other creating six french braids.

Cut small pieces of your red and white flowers and place them in between the small folds created by the braids. Alternate between red and white, starting at the top of your head and working your way down the back.
